What specific functionalities increase accuracy in hunting at night?

The AGM Adder thermal vision scope offers multiple color palettes, including white hot, black hot, red hot, and others, helping hunters choose the best display for their environment. With a maximum detection range of over 1,200 meters and adjustable zoom capabilities of up to 8 times, the Night Hunting Rifle Scope ADDER ensures that hunters can achieve pinpoint accuracy in targeting even at great distances.

Exploring How the AGM Adder Thermal Vision Scope Sharpens Target Identification

The AGM Adder Thermal Vision Scope aids in identifying targets through its advanced image processing technology and customizable reticles, which provide clearer identification at greater distances. Thermal vision helps hunters discern animal movement at night by detecting the heat they generate, while factors such as ambient temperature and moisture can affect the performance of thermal scopes in different environments.
